Output 326ab6139f2ccbaebbe96e5256d57d680a9c1a75e4897e4081aadc83062d5809:0

value
34897924
script pubkey
OP_0 OP_PUSHBYTES_20 1dc53d6b671ffbe2a711381838dcfe3618a4bd17
address
bc1qrhzn66m8rla79fc38qvr3h87xcv2f0ghx56nlc
transaction
326ab6139f2ccbaebbe96e5256d57d680a9c1a75e4897e4081aadc83062d5809
spent
true